数值变文本函数(数转文本函数)
作者:路由通
|

发布时间:2025-05-03 00:08:22
标签:
数值变文本函数是数据处理与展示的核心工具,其本质是将数值型数据转换为可读性更强的文本格式。这类函数在数据可视化、报表生成、用户界面交互等场景中具有不可替代的作用。从技术实现角度看,它不仅涉及基础的类型转换逻辑,还需兼顾不同平台的语法特性、区

数值变文本函数是数据处理与展示的核心工具,其本质是将数值型数据转换为可读性更强的文本格式。这类函数在数据可视化、报表生成、用户界面交互等场景中具有不可替代的作用。从技术实现角度看,它不仅涉及基础的类型转换逻辑,还需兼顾不同平台的语法特性、区域化格式适配以及性能优化。例如,Excel的TEXT函数通过格式化代码实现数值转文本,而Python的f-string则依赖动态插值机制。随着大数据与人工智能的发展,数值变文本函数正从简单的格式化工具演变为支持智能分类、动态渲染和多模态输出的复杂系统。
一、核心定义与基础特性
数值变文本函数指将数字、浮点数、日期等数值类型数据转换为字符串形式的算法或方法。其核心特性包括:
- 格式可控性:通过参数定义小数位数、千位分隔符、货币符号等
- 类型适应性:支持整数、浮点数、时间戳等多元数值类型
- 区域敏感性:根据地域标准自动调整日期/货币格式
特性维度 | Excel | Python | SQL |
---|---|---|---|
基础语法 | TEXT(数值,格式代码) | f"数值:格式说明" | FORMAT(数值,格式) |
日期处理 | "yyyy-mm-dd"格式 | datetime.strftime() | TO_CHAR(date,'Format') |
性能表现 | 中等(VBA环境) | 高(CPython底层优化) | 低(数据库引擎解析) |
二、跨平台实现机制对比
不同技术栈的实现原理存在显著差异:
- Excel体系:基于单元格计算模型,采用预定义格式代码(如",0.00"),通过FIND/SEARCH函数实现特殊字符定位
- Python生态:依托格式化字符串协议,支持精度控制(如:.2f)、对齐方式(如:<10),兼容Unicode编码
- SQL存储过程:结合RDBMS特性,使用CAST/CONVERT函数,需注意NLS参数对区域格式的影响
关键参数 | Excel | Python | SQL |
---|---|---|---|
正负数处理 | ";"(红字) | 空格填充 | 括号包裹 |
小数控制 | .00表示两位 | .2f格式说明 | ROUND(num,2) |
千分位 | ,号分隔 | ,选项启用 | 999,999格式 |
三、典型应用场景分析
该类函数的应用边界持续扩展:
- 财务领域:发票金额格式化(如¥1,234.56)、会计科目编号转换
- 数据可视化:坐标轴标签生成、热力图数值标注
- 用户界面:动态数据显示(如文件大小KB/MB/GB自动转换)
- 日志系统:时间戳格式化(2023-08-15 14:30:00)
四、性能优化策略
处理大规模数据时需注意:
- 缓存机制:预先生成格式模板,避免重复解析格式字符串
- 批量处理:数组/集合级联转换,减少函数调用开销
- 算法优化:舍入误差消除、最小化内存拷贝次数
测试场景 | 转换速度(万次/秒) | 内存占用(KB) |
---|---|---|
Excel 10^5行数据 | 12 | 5,200 |
Python list推导式 | 3,500 | 800 |
SQL PL/SQL存储过程 | 250 | 1,500 |
五、常见错误与异常处理
实际应用中需防范:
六、区域化适配方案
全球化应用需构建多维适配体系:
七、前沿技术融合趋势
当前技术演进呈现:
八、安全与合规性要求
金融级应用需满足:
随着数字化转型的深化,数值变文本函数正从单纯的技术工具演变为连接数据与人类认知的重要桥梁。未来的发展将聚焦于智能化、场景化和安全化三个维度:通过机器学习实现格式建议自动化,结合AR/VR技术创造沉浸式数据体验,同时构建抗量子攻击的加密转换体系。开发者需要建立跨平台思维,在保证基础功能可靠性的前提下,探索与新兴技术的融合路径。值得注意的是,随着物联网设备的普及,嵌入式系统中的轻量化实现将成为新的技术热点,这要求函数设计在保持功能性的同时,最大限度降低资源占用。最终,数值变文本函数将突破传统数据处理范畴,成为人机交互的核心组件,推动数据智能向更高层次的语义理解迈进。
相关文章
在移动互联网时代,微信作为月活超13亿的超级流量平台,已成为装修行业获客与品牌建设的核心阵地。装修微信营销需围绕用户生命周期构建全链路运营体系,通过精准定位、内容赋能、社交裂变和数据驱动,实现从流量获取到转化的闭环。相较于传统线下推广,微信
2025-05-03 00:08:19

在抖音平台发布图片视频已成为内容创作的重要形式,其核心优势在于视觉冲击力强、制作门槛低且适配碎片化传播场景。与传统视频相比,图片视频通过静态画面组合搭配音乐、特效和文字,既能快速传递信息,又能通过节奏控制延长用户停留时间。根据抖音公开数据,
2025-05-03 00:08:17

对数函数作为高中数学核心知识模块,其题型设计兼具基础运算与综合应用的双重特点。从教学实践来看,该类题目主要围绕函数定义、图像特征、运算规律展开,同时深度关联指数函数、二次函数等知识体系。学生需突破定义域限制、底数分类讨论、参数范围求解等典型
2025-05-03 00:08:15

JavaScript函数表达式是动态脚本编程的核心机制之一,其设计融合了灵活性、复用性与执行环境适配性。作为一类特殊的函数定义形式,它通过将函数赋值给变量实现匿名化或延迟绑定,突破了传统函数声明的语法限制。相较于函数声明,表达式允许在任意代
2025-05-03 00:08:09

微信公众号H5页面作为移动端营销的重要载体,其设计与开发需兼顾用户体验、技术适配、传播效率及数据转化。随着微信生态的成熟,H5页面不仅是品牌展示的窗口,更是用户互动、数据沉淀和流量变现的核心工具。制作过程中需平衡视觉吸引力、功能实用性、平台
2025-05-03 00:08:05

小米路由器4A千兆版作为一款面向家庭用户的高性价比千兆路由设备,其设置过程兼顾易用性与功能性。该设备采用MT7986A芯片方案,支持Wave2 MU-MIMO技术,配备4个全千兆网口,可满足多设备并发需求。初始设置需通过米家APP或网页端完
2025-05-03 00:08:02

热门推荐